XML

XML Main Site

  1. W3C
  2. XML.COM
  3. XMLHACK.COM
  4. XMLINFO.COM
  5. XMLSOFTWARE.COM - collect list of tool like XML editor, parser, XLink, XSLT editor/formatter/engine ...
  6. IBM XML
  7. IBM alphaworks site
  8. James Clark - expat, XP, XT ...
  9. OASIS XML Cover Pages
  10. XML FAQ
  11. Microsoft XML Developer Center

Course/Project by me

  1. XML COURSE
  2. BBAS - a E-Journal Project

Related Site

  1. OASIS: Organization for the Advancement of Structured Information Standards
  2. ZDNet devhead - XML
  3. xslt.com - Resource site for XML, XSLT, XSL. Sablotron is a free XSLT processor in C++

TEI

  1. The Pizza Chef: a TEI Tag Set Selector
  2. XSL stylesheets for TEI XML

Some Material here

  1. Use LotusXSL on 'gate' host (ctchang)
  2. Internet Explorer Tools for Validating XML and Viewing XSLT Output (ctchang)
  3. using MS XML Validator (ctchang)

Tutorials/Articles

  1. OASIS XML ARTICLES /WHITE PAPERS
  2. Resources on computing with Java 2 and XML
  3. Microsoft MSDN XML Developer Center
  4. Microsoft XML
  5. XSL Tutorial (IE5 flavor)
  6. XSL Presentation/Tutorial
  7. XML/CSS/XSL Tutorial
  8. Microsoft XSL
  9. Perl XML FAQ
  10. Introduction to XML - 13 October 1998
  11. XML Overview
  12. XML and the IT architect (very good basic tutorial)
  13. RDF - What's in it for us?
  14. 可延伸標記語言(XML)-建立自己的標記程式語言 CNET台灣
  15. 可延伸標記語言( XML)-建立自己的標記程式語言 PDF, 在第 3, 4 頁
  16. XSL Tutorial
  17. XML Seminars, Tutorials, and Presentations by Elliotte Rusty Harold
  18. XLinks and XPointers (presentation)
  19. XPointer tutorial
  20. XSLT Tutorial / XML Schema Tutorial (in Powerpoint, with examples and exercise)

Chinese XML related

  1. Chinese XML Now !

XML tools

  1. Perl extension module XML::Parser
  2. Perl XML::DOM module
  3. Using The XML::Parser Module
  4. Internet Explorer Tools for Validating XML and Viewing XSLT Output (2001/4/17)
    1. select "Web Development/XML/Internet Explorer Tools for Validating XML and Viewing XSLT Output"
    2. download
    3. run "iexmltls.exe" to extract file into a directory
    4. In explorer, right-click on .inf file, and select "Install"
    5. open your .xml file, right-click on browser, and select validate

CSS

  1. Microsoft CSS
  2. Inside Dynamic HTML - CSS Online

tools in C++/C

  1. fXML - open source C++, cross-platform XML toolkit
  2. Summary of XML Parser Performance Testing
  3. What is expat? Overview/Function Reference
  4. autoconfigured version of Expat available (2000/4/1)

XML Editors

  1. Easy XML
  2. XMLSpy (support Big5)
  3. HTML-kit

Commercial

  1. XDev DataChannel - XJParser, XML Cookbook, Samples.
  2. for XML VB, ASp and Cold Fusion developers!
  3. XDEV - XML indexing engine

Mailing List/Disussion Groups

  1. XSL-List
  2. xml-dev
  3. RDF Discussion

XML Applications

  1. OCS - Open Content Syndication. designed to enable channel listings to be constructed for use by portal sites, client based headline software and other similar applications.
  2. RSS - Rich Site Summary from Netscape. for syndicated content.
  3. RSSMaker

Misc.

  1. Tutorial on XML and Java
  2. Koala XSL Engine
    This package also contains xslSlideMaker, a post-processor that can quickly make slides and multi-level slides with XML & XSL." - from the product page
  3. XML in XML (XML in IE5, a XML file with float)
  4. 國立高雄第一科技大學文件交換實驗室朱四明教授的文件交換實驗室.
  5. 行政院研考會電子公文
  6. 前瞻策略研討會 - 資訊 / 電子產業供應鏈整合

Open Source XML Application Server

  1. Enhydra is an Open Source Java/XML application server
  2. XML Application Server (XAS) - Planet 7 Technologies
  3. XML at Jetspeed Jetspeed, part of the Java Apache Project, is a project to create an XML-based enterprise information portal. Naturally, being part of the Apache Project, it's open source.